About This Item
Chicago IL: J.V. Martenson, 1913. 138 pages. Gilt titles with embossed covers. Lightly illustrated. Frontispiece: author and Thyra (daughter?). List of Scandinavian Alliance Missionaries of North America (1891-1911) on last page. Mild corner bumps and wear to spine ends. Small tear at upper edge of last page. Gilt on front cover bold - near new. Interior pages nearly pristine.. Green Cloth. Very Good +/No Jacket.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all.
